The Refurbishing Process

Refurbishing sash windows is a thorough procedure that requires skilled artisans to make sure the windows are brought back to their initial grandeur.

Actions Involved in Refurbishing Sash Windows

  1. Evaluation: An extensive inspection of the windows is carried out to recognize issues such as rot, damaged cables, and paint degeneration.
  2. Elimination of Sashes: The sashes are carefully eliminated from the window frame to allow for detailed work.
  3. Repair and Restoration: This includes replacing rotting wood, repairing harmed joints, and renewing the sash cords and weights.
  4. Removing and Sanding: Old paint and finishes are removed away to prepare the wood for a fresh coat. Sanding smooths the surface area for a refined surface.
  5. Paint or Finish Application: High-quality paint or preservatives are used to enhance aesthetic appeal and protect the wood from future damage.
  6. Reinstallation: Finally, the sashes are reinstalled, guaranteeing that all mechanisms operate efficiently.

Table of Costs for Sash Window Refurbishing Services

ServiceApproximated Cost
Initial Assessment₤ 50 - ₤ 100
Sash Removal and Reinstallation₤ 150 - ₤ 300 per sash
Repair of Rotting Wood₤ 100 - ₤ 200 per sash
Replacement of Sash Cords₤ 50 - ₤ 100 per sash
Complete Stripping and Painting₤ 100 - ₤ 200 per sash
Overall Refurbishing Cost (Typical)₤ 300 - ₤ 600 per sash

When to Consider Professional Help

While some house owners might pick to handle small repairs themselves, particular scenarios necessitate the proficiency of professionals:

Signs You Should Hire a Professional

  • Substantial Rot: If there shows up wood rot or damage that extends beyond shallow repairs.
  • Draughts: Persistent draughts may indicate substantial gaps or structural concerns that need professional evaluation.
  • Trouble in Operation: If the sashes are stuck or tough to operate after efforts at DIY repair.
  • Historical Value: Homes with considerable historic value might need specialists who understand the value of preserving authenticity.

FAQs about Sash Window Refurbishing Services

1. How long does the refurbishing procedure typically take?

The timeframe depends on the number of windows and their condition however typically varies from a few days to several weeks.

2. Will I have to replace the whole sash window?

Not usually. Refurbishing focuses on fixing and restoring what is already there, frequently getting rid of the need for replacement.
